			If you've gone to the link to check your answers, be wary that they are correct.  Case in point, #17.  The author of the link says the ball is dead when it hits the runner, even though it has PASSED a fielder.  I was taught according to the rule book, that once a batted ball passes a fielder and no other fielder has a chance to field it, if it hits a runner it will remain LIVE.  The link author says he has verified his answers by submitting his test to the NCAA.  I think either he missed something or the NCAA did on at least this question - your guess as to who is correct.
